In the ever-evolving landscape of manufacturing, companies are increasingly turning to technology to address various operational barriers. A recent discussion highlighted several key strategies that can enhance efficiency and productivity within the sector.
One of the primary insights revolves around the implementation of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) systems. These comprehensive software solutions streamline processes by integrating various functions such as inventory management, production scheduling, and financial reporting into a single platform. This integration not only minimizes data silos but also fosters better communication across departments, leading to improved decision-making.
Furthermore, manufacturers are encouraged to adopt automation technologies. By automating repetitive tasks, companies can reduce human error and free up valuable resources for more strategic initiatives. Additionally, utilizing data analytics tools allows manufacturers to gain deeper insights into their operations, enabling them to identify inefficiencies and areas for improvement.
As the industry continues to face challenges such as supply chain disruptions and labor shortages, embracing these technological advancements has become essential for manufacturers aiming to remain competitive and resilient in the market.
